上一页 1 ··· 3 4 5 6 7 8 9 10 11 下一页

2018年10月12日

Java线程-线程的基本状态

摘要: 问题:线程有哪些基本状态?这些状态是如何定义的? 新建(new):新创建了一个线程对象。 可运行(runnable):线程对象创建后,其他线程(比如main线程)调用了该对象的start()方法。该状态的线程位于可运行线程池中,等待被线程调度选中,获取cpu的使用权。 运行(running):可运行 阅读全文

posted @ 2018-10-12 11:37 moonlight.ml 阅读(1259) 评论(0) 推荐(0) 编辑

Java线程-线程、程序、进程的基本概念

摘要: 线程 与进程相似,但线程是一个比进程更小的执行单位。一个进程在其执行的过程中可以产生多个线程。 与进程不同的是同类的多个线程共享同一块内存空间和一组系统资源,所以系统在产生一个线程,或是在各个线程之间作切换工作时,负担要比进程小得多,也正因为如此,线程也被称为轻量级进程。 程序 是含有指令和数据的文 阅读全文

posted @ 2018-10-12 11:17 moonlight.ml 阅读(572) 评论(0) 推荐(0) 编辑

Java语法基础-static关键字

摘要: static关键字说明 “static方法就是没有this的方法。在static方法内部不能调用非静态方法,反过来是可以的。而且可以在没有创建任何对象的前提下,仅仅通过类本身来调用static方法。这实际上正是static方法的主要用途。” 这段话虽然只是说明了static方法的特殊之处,但是可以看 阅读全文

posted @ 2018-10-12 11:13 moonlight.ml 阅读(123) 评论(0) 推荐(0) 编辑

Java语法基础-final关键字

摘要: final关键字主要用在三个地方:变量、方法、类。 对于一个final变量,如果是基本数据类型的变量,则其数值一旦在初始化之后便不能更改; 如果是引用类型的变量,则在对其初始化之后便不能再让其指向另一个对象。 当用final修饰一个类时,表明这个类不能被继承。 final类中的所有成员方法都会被隐式 阅读全文

posted @ 2018-10-12 11:03 moonlight.ml 阅读(231) 评论(0) 推荐(0) 编辑

Java语法基础-异常处理

摘要: 异常处理类层次结构图 检查异常与非检查异常 非检查异常(unckecked exception):Error 和 RuntimeException 以及他们的子类。javac在编译时,不会提示和发现这样的异常,不要求在程序处理这些异常。所以如果愿意,我们可以编写代码处理(使用try…catch…fi 阅读全文

posted @ 2018-10-12 10:37 moonlight.ml 阅读(313) 评论(0) 推荐(0) 编辑

Java语法基础-序列化

摘要: 33. Java序列化中如果有些字段不想进行序列化,怎么办? 答:对于不想进行序列化的变量,使用transient关键字修饰。 transient关键字的作用是:阻止实例中那些用此关键字修饰的的变量序列化;当对象被反序列化时,被transient修饰的变量值不会被持久化和恢复。transient只能 阅读全文

posted @ 2018-10-12 10:03 moonlight.ml 阅读(205) 评论(0) 推荐(0) 编辑

2018年10月11日

Java的知识储备及面试-几个方面

摘要: 1.Java本身语法基础 https://github.com/Snailclimb/JavaGuide/blob/master/Java%E7%9B%B8%E5%85%B3/Java%E5%9F%BA%E7%A1%80%E7%9F%A5%E8%AF%86.md主要包括:Java语言特点、数据类型、 阅读全文

posted @ 2018-10-11 18:25 moonlight.ml 阅读(365) 评论(0) 推荐(0) 编辑

一篇分析测试开发人员的职业发展方向的好文章-学习笔记

摘要: 老生常谈,再谈谈测试职业发展 TesterHome: https://testerhome.com/topics/16354 书籍 测试基础,测试思维:《ISTQB基础教程》《高级软件测试设计》《高级软件测试管理》 网络TCP/IP:《图解tcp/ip》《图解Http》 测试人优秀特质 快速学习、系 阅读全文

posted @ 2018-10-11 12:03 moonlight.ml 阅读(490) 评论(0) 推荐(0) 编辑

web 自动化测试 selenium基础到应用(目录)

摘要: 第一章 自动化测试前提及整体介绍 1-1功能测试和自动化测试的区别 1-2自动化测试流程有哪些 1-3自动化测试用例和手工用例的区别 1-4 自动化测试用例编写 1-5 selenium的优势以及工作原理 第二章 Selenium基础知识回顾 2-1 IDE及环境配置 2-2 HTML定位基础知识 阅读全文

posted @ 2018-10-11 11:41 moonlight.ml 阅读(794) 评论(0) 推荐(0) 编辑

2018年7月15日

打包Scala jar 包的正确步骤

摘要: 实验目的:打包可运行的scala jar,上传到spark集群,提交执行 1.idea中编译运行代码,可成功运行 2.修改2处代码//只配置appName,其他配置项注释掉val conf=new SparkConf() .setAppName("pageRank")//文件加载路径设为空,在提交执 阅读全文

posted @ 2018-07-15 10:56 moonlight.ml 阅读(7125) 评论(0) 推荐(0) 编辑

上一页 1 ··· 3 4 5 6 7 8 9 10 11 下一页

导航